编程显示动态壁纸什么意思
-
编程显示动态壁纸的意思是通过编写计算机程序,实现在桌面背景上显示具有动态效果的壁纸。传统的壁纸通常是静态的图片,而动态壁纸则可以根据设定的规则或操作进行变化和交互。
动态壁纸的实现一般通过以下步骤:
1.选择合适的编程语言和平台:根据自己的喜好和所用平台的要求,可以选择合适的编程语言和开发环境。常见的编程语言包括C++、Java、Python等。
2.获取壁纸引擎或框架:根据选择的编程语言,可以使用相应的壁纸引擎或框架来简化开发过程。比如,对于Windows平台,可以使用Rainmeter或Wallpaper Engine等工具。
3.编写动态壁纸代码:根据需求,使用编程语言编写代码来实现动态壁纸的效果。可以通过读取系统时间、用户输入或其他传感器数据,来实现壁纸的变化。也可以使用图形处理技术,如动画、渐变、粒子效果等来增加动态感。
4.调试和测试:编写完代码后,需要进行调试和测试,确保动态壁纸在各种情况下正常运行,并能适应不同的屏幕分辨率和显示模式。
5.发布和安装:完成调试后,可以将动态壁纸打包成可执行文件或安装程序,然后发布到相关的平台上,供用户使用。
需要注意的是,动态壁纸可能会消耗较多的计算资源,特别是在较旧的计算机上运行时可能会导致性能下降。因此,在开发动态壁纸时需要注意平衡效果和性能的问题。此外,还应兼顾用户体验,保证动态壁纸的操作和切换流畅,不影响其他应用程序的正常使用。
总而言之,通过编程显示动态壁纸意味着可以将创造力和个性融入到桌面背景中,为用户提供更加丰富和个性化的电脑使用体验。
1年前 -
编程显示动态壁纸是指通过编程技术将动态效果应用于计算机桌面壁纸的过程。传统的壁纸通常是静态的图片或图案,而动态壁纸则可以通过添加动画、特效、视频或实时信息等来增加桌面的视觉效果和互动性。
以下是关于编程显示动态壁纸的一些概念和方法:
-
壁纸引擎:动态壁纸通常需要使用壁纸引擎来实现。壁纸引擎是一种软件程序,用于管理和显示动态壁纸。它通常提供了各种特效和配置选项,允许用户选择不同的动态壁纸和自定义其外观和行为。
-
编程语言和工具:要编写和实现动态壁纸,需要使用编程语言和相关的开发工具。常用的编程语言包括Java、C++、Python等。开发工具可以是集成开发环境(IDE)或特定的壁纸引擎SDK。
-
动态效果:编程显示的动态壁纸可以包括各种动态效果,如粒子效果、流体仿真、物理模拟等。这些效果可以通过编程算法和图形渲染技术实现。例如,可以使用OpenGL或Unity等图形库来创建复杂的3D动画或游戏效果。
-
数据源:动态壁纸通常需要获取来自不同数据源的实时信息。这些数据源可以是互联网上的数据、传感器收集的环境数据、用户输入等。通过编程技术,可以将这些信息与动态壁纸的呈现和交互行为绑定在一起,实现个性化的动态效果。
-
用户交互和配置:动态壁纸通常提供了一些用户交互和配置选项,允许用户自定义壁纸的外观和行为。通过编程技术,可以实现用户界面和设置菜单,使用户能够选择不同的动态壁纸、调整特效参数、切换数据源等。
动态壁纸在提供视觉上的享受和个性化桌面体验方面非常受欢迎。通过编程显示动态壁纸,可以创造出各种独特的壁纸效果,并且可以根据用户的需求进行定制和扩展。
1年前 -
-
编程显示动态壁纸是指通过编写代码,实现在计算机桌面上显示可动态变化的壁纸。动态壁纸可以是以视频、动画、GIF或者实时数据等形式展示的壁纸,与传统的静态壁纸相比,能够给用户带来更加生动、丰富的使用体验。
实现编程显示动态壁纸一般需要以下步骤:
-
选择编程语言和开发环境:首先需要选择适合自己的编程语言和开发环境。常见的编程语言包括C++、Python、JavaScript等,在选择开发环境时可以考虑使用专门用于桌面应用开发的集成开发环境(IDE)。
-
熟悉操作系统:了解所使用的操作系统的壁纸设置方式以及开发相关文档。不同操作系统有不同的壁纸设置接口和限制条件,需要根据实际情况选择合适的开发方案。
-
获取动态壁纸素材:动态壁纸需要使用到相应的素材,可以从网上下载或者自己制作。素材可以是视频、动画、GIF或者实时数据等形式。确保所使用的素材文件格式和大小符合要求。
-
编写代码:根据所选的编程语言和开发环境,编写代码来实现动态壁纸的显示效果。代码的实现逻辑包括读取素材文件、解析文件内容、播放动画或者实时数据等。
-
配置壁纸设置:将编写好的程序设置为操作系统的壁纸设置。具体的设置方式会根据不同的操作系统而有所不同,一般可以通过系统设置中的壁纸选项来进行设置。
在编写代码的过程中,可以根据需要添加一些额外的功能,如自定义设置项、分辨率适配、动态效果控制等。此外,还可以利用相关的图形库或框架来简化开发过程。
总结来说,编程显示动态壁纸的意思是通过编写代码,实现在计算机桌面上显示可动态变化的壁纸。完成该任务需要选择合适的编程语言和开发环境,熟悉操作系统的壁纸设置方式,获取相应的动态壁纸素材,并通过编写代码实现动态壁纸的显示效果。
1年前 -